About the Book
Bangla Prabad: Bahukounik Dristi (Bengali Version) is an engaging and research-oriented study of Bengali proverbs, examining them through multiple critical and cultural perspectives. Proverbs are among the most enduring forms of folk wisdom, carrying within them the experiences, values, beliefs, and collective consciousness of generations. This book seeks to uncover the deeper meanings embedded in these concise yet powerful expressions of popular culture.
Through a multidimensional approach, Ajijul Haq Mondal analyzes Bengali proverbs as reflections of society, culture, language, and human behavior. The study demonstrates how proverbs serve as valuable cultural documents, preserving insights into social relationships, moral values, occupational practices, gender roles, and community life. By examining the worldview embedded within proverbial expressions, the author reveals the close relationship between language and society.
A significant aspect of the book is its linguistic exploration of proverbs. The author investigates the structure, style, imagery, symbolism, and expressive techniques that contribute to the effectiveness and longevity of proverbial language. These discussions help readers appreciate the artistic and communicative power of proverbs beyond their everyday usage.
The volume also includes a comparative analysis of Bengali and Hindi proverbs, highlighting both shared cultural patterns and distinctive regional characteristics. Through this comparative perspective, readers gain insight into the ways different linguistic communities express similar experiences while maintaining unique cultural identities. The study thus contributes not only to folklore research but also to comparative literary and cultural studies.
Concise yet rich in insight, the book reflects the careful scholarship and intellectual curiosity of an emerging researcher. It introduces fresh perspectives on a familiar subject and encourages readers to look beyond the surface meanings of proverbs to discover the cultural and historical narratives they contain.
An important resource for students, researchers, folklorists, linguists, and anyone interested in Bengali folk culture, Bangla Prabad: Bahukounik Dristi offers a thoughtful and accessible exploration of one of the most fascinating forms of traditional wisdom.
